Bust _membership_stream_cache cache when current state changes (#17732)
This is particularly a problem in a state reset scenario where the membership might change without a corresponding event. This PR is targeting a scenario where a state reset happens which causes room membership to change. Previously, the cache would just hold onto stale data and now we properly bust the cache in this scenario. We have a few tests for these scenarios which you can see are now fixed because we can remove the `FIXME` where we were previously manually busting the cache in the test itself. This is a general Synapse thing so by it's nature it helps out Sliding Sync.
